The Financial Regulatory Authority (FRA) issued Decision No. (50) of 2020 mandating that all Egyptian unions of companies and entities operating in non-banking financial activities must include at least one female member on their boards of directors. The decision requires these unions to amend their statutes to comply with this quota by December 31, 2020, or at their next board election, whichever comes first. This regulation takes effect the day after its publication in the Egyptian Gazette and on the FRA website, reinforcing gender diversity requirements across the sector's governing bodies.
FINANCIAL REGULATORY AUTHORITY
No. (50) of 2020 dated 22/3/2020
Regarding the mandatory inclusion of a female member in the boards of directors of unions
of companies and entities operating in the field of non-banking financial activities
Having reviewed Law No. (10) of 2009 regulating supervision over non-banking financial markets and instruments;
and Decision No. (35) of 2013 of the Board of Directors regarding the Articles of Association of the Egyptian Insurance Union;
and Decision No. (7) of 2015 of the Board of Directors regarding the Articles of Association of the Egyptian Microfinance Union;
and Decision No. (41) of 2015 of the Board of Directors regarding the Articles of Association of the Egyptian Real Estate Finance Union;
and Decision No. (20) of 2019 of the Board of Directors regarding the Articles of Association of the Egyptian Securities Union;
and Decision No. (149) of 2019 of the Board of Directors regarding the Articles of Association of the Union of Companies Operating in the Financial Leasing Activity;
and Decision No. (150) of 2019 of the Board of Directors regarding the Articles of Association of the Union of Companies Operating in the Factoring Activity;
and upon the approval of the Board of Directors in its meeting held on 22/3/2020;
(Article One)
The composition of the boards of directors of the Egyptian unions of companies and entities operating in the field of non-banking financial activities, as stipulated in the aforementioned Board decisions, must include at least one female member.
This decision shall be published in the Egyptian Gazette and on the Authority's website, and shall take effect from the day following its publication in the Egyptian Gazette.
